Statement by Member of Parliament Iqra Khalid regarding the Ongoing Situation in Jerusalem and Sheikh Jarrah
I have been watching with horror as the aggression and violence continues to escalate in East Jerusalem, Sheikh Jarrah and the whole region. I strongly condemn the violence that has cost too many lives and injured countless more, including at the Al Aqsa Mosque. These actions in and around Haram al-Sharif/Temple Mount are unacceptable, especially during the Holy month of Ramadan.
Over these past few days, I have heard many voices in Mississauga-Erin Mills raise their concerns for the people in Jerusalem and Sheikh Jarrah. This violence and blatant disregard for human life has killed innocent civilians, including children. It must stop. Local authorities must show leadership and fulfill their duty to protect all civilians and uphold international laws.
I do not believe that peace is a zero-sum game. All parties must act to end this violent conflict, including halting the continued forced evictions of Palestinian families. The global community must collaborate to help build a two-state solution for the sake of future generations.
The Government of Canada is gravely concerned by the escalating violence, settlements, and forced evictions of Palestinian families. These actions do not serve international law and take us further away from a two-state solution. Canada remains fully committed to the goal of a comprehensive, just, and lasting peace, including the creation of a Palestinian state living side by side in peace and security with Israel.
I have expressed my concerns publicly on multiple occasions over the last few days. As the Member of Parliament for Mississauga-Erin Mills, I will always stand against the violation of human rights around the world. I support a peaceful resolution that reinforces compassion and respect for, and among, all residents of Jerusalem and Sheikh Jarrah.
